<div dir="ltr">Что-то вы лукавите.<div><br></div><div>1. Верните все к дефолтным настройкам</div><div><br></div><div>2. Добейтесь работы страницы index.php с содержанием <?php phpinfo(); ?></div><div><br></div><div>3. Проверьте сами себя через netstat</div><div><br></div><div>$ sudo netstat -lnudxtp</div><div><br></div><div>У вас должно быть:</div><div>...</div><div>tcp 0 0 <IP-адрес>:80 0.0.0.0:* LISTEN 731/nginx<br></div><div>...</div><div>Active UNIX domain sockets (only servers)<br></div><div>...</div><div>unix 2 [ ACC ] STREAM LISTENING 2504321925 569/php-fpm <путь к сокету>>/php-fpm.sock<br></div><div><br></div><div>Если php запущен через сокет</div><div><br></div></div><div class="gmail_extra"><br><div class="gmail_quote">2015-12-29 22:58 GMT+03:00 <span dir="ltr"><<a href="mailto:admin@goplexltd.com" target="_blank">admin@goplexltd.com</a>></span>: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">OS Debian 8<br>
php-fpm - не менялся<br>
fastcgi_pass unix:/var/run/php5-fpm.sock; эта строчка из дефолтного конфига, с ней 502 (<br>
<br>
29.12.2015, 19:55, "Ivan Palanevich" <<a href="mailto:loverjoni@gmail.com">loverjoni@gmail.com</a>>:<br>
<div class="HOEnZb"><div class="h5">> Какая версия OS? конфиг php-fpm менялся?<br>
><br>
> Попробуйте вместо<br>
> include <путь к конфигу fastcgi параметров>/fastcgi_rules.conf;<br>
> написать<br>
> fastcgi_pass unix:/var/run/php5-fpm.sock;<br>
><br>
> Ivan Palanevich<br>
><br>
>> 29 дек. 2015 г., в 22:52, <a href="mailto:admin@goplexltd.com">admin@goplexltd.com</a> написал(а):<br>
>><br>
>> Извините за невежество, как узнать <путь к конфигу fastcgi параметров>?<br>
>> Ни как не могу нагуглить(<br>
>><br>
>> 29.12.2015, 19:48, "Dmitry" <<a href="mailto:dmitry.goryainov@gmail.com">dmitry.goryainov@gmail.com</a>>:<br>
>>> Ок, давайте посмотрим на вот такой конфиг:<br>
>>><br>
>>> server {<br>
>>> listen *:80;<br>
>>> server_name <домен>;<br>
>>> location / {<br>
>>> root <путь к корню веб-сервер>;<br>
>>><br>
>>> index index.php index.html;<br>
>>><br>
>>> try_files $uri $uri/ /rw.php$is_args$args;<br>
>>><br>
>>> location ~ \.php {<br>
>>> include <путь к конфигу fastcgi параметров>/fastcgi_rules.conf;<br>
>>> }<br>
>>> }<br>
>>><br>
>>> работает ли?<br>
>>><br>
>>> 2015-12-29 22:43 GMT+03:00 <<a href="mailto:admin@goplexltd.com">admin@goplexltd.com</a>>:<br>
>>>> PHP запущен, страница phpinfo открывается коректно и отдает информацию.<br>
>>>><br>
>>>> 29.12.2015, 19:41, "Dmitry" <<a href="mailto:dmitry.goryainov@gmail.com">dmitry.goryainov@gmail.com</a>>:<br>
>>>><br>
>>>>> 1. До того, как настроите перенаправление, проверьте что у вас вообще запущен php и отвечает nginx'у<br>
>>>>><br>
>>>>> 2. После того как сами себе докажите, что php у вас работает и выводит страницу типа <?php phpinfo(); ?> тога вернитесь к настройкам nginx.<br>
>>>>><br>
>>>>> Мне искренне кажется, что у вас сам php не запущен и не отвечает. Впрочем, мне вообще не нравиться его вариант запуска на порту, а не через сокет<br>
>>>>><br>
>>>>> 2015-12-29 22:36 GMT+03:00 <<a href="mailto:admin@goplexltd.com">admin@goplexltd.com</a>>:<br>
>>>>>> Ничего не понимаю, поясните пожалуйста подробнее если не сложно, я только начинаю изучать администрирование серверов.<br>
>>>>>> Вчем мои ошибки и что мне исправить что бы все заработало?<br>
>>>>>><br>
>>>>>> 29.12.2015, 12:25, "Сухарников Евгений" <<a href="mailto:suharelli@gmail.com">suharelli@gmail.com</a>>:<br>
>>>>>>> Если php-fpm не ковырял, скорее всего он из коробки слушает сокет.<br>
>>>>>>><br>
>>>>>>> fastcgi_pass unix:/var/run/php5-fpm.sock;<br>
>>>>>>><br>
>>>>>>> 29 декабря 2015 г., 22:03 пользователь Lystopad Aleksandr <<a href="mailto:laa@laa.zp.ua">laa@laa.zp.ua</a>> написал:<br>
>>>>>>>> Hello, <a href="mailto:admin@goplexltd.com">admin@goplexltd.com</a>!<br>
>>>>>>>><br>
>>>>>>>> On Tue, Dec 29, 2015 at 11:56:02AM +0000<br>
>>>>>>>> <a href="mailto:admin@goplexltd.com">admin@goplexltd.com</a> wrote about "Re: Помогите правильно написать конфиг для CMS":<br>
>>>>>>>>> Домен и пути я естественно поменял на свои.<br>
>>>>>>>>> Испробывал все варианты предложенные вами, все равно получаю 502.<br>
>>>>>>>>> Итоговый вариант конфига на котором пока остановился-<br>
>>>>>>>>> server {<br>
>>>>>>>>> server_name <a href="http://www.domain.com" rel="noreferrer" target="_blank">www.domain.com</a>;<br>
>>>>>>>>> rewrite ^(.*) <a href="http://domain.com" rel="noreferrer" target="_blank">http://domain.com</a>$1 permanent;<br>
>>>>>>>>> }<br>
>>>>>>>>><br>
>>>>>>>>> server {<br>
>>>>>>>>><br>
>>>>>>>>> server_name <a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>;<br>
>>>>>>>>><br>
>>>>>>>>> location / {<br>
>>>>>>>>> fastcgi_pass localhost:9000;<br>
>>>>>>>>> fastcgi_param SCRIPT_FILENAME $document_root/rw.php;<br>
>>>>>>>>> fastcgi_param QUERY_STRING $query_string;<br>
>>>>>>>>> }<br>
>>>>>>>>><br>
>>>>>>>>> location ~ \.(gif|jpg|png|ico|swf|txt|js|css|zip|htc|ttf)$ {<br>
>>>>>>>>> root /var/www/html/images;<br>
>>>>>>>>> }<br>
>>>>>>>>> }<br>
>>>>>>>>><br>
>>>>>>>>> Логи nginx<br>
>>>>>>>>><br>
>>>>>>>>> 2015/12/29 06:37:07 [error] 11380#0: *20 no live upstreams while connecting to upstream, client: 88.202.***.**, server: <a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>, request: "GET / HTTP/1.1", upstream: "fastcgi://localhost", host: "<a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>"<br>
>>>>>>>>> 2015/12/29 06:37:08 [error] 11380#0: *21 connect() failed (111: Connection refused) while connecting to upstream, client: 88.202.***.**, server: <a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>, request: "GET / HTTP/1.1", upstream: "fastcgi://[::1]:9000", host: "<a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>"<br>
>>>>>>>>> 2015/12/29 06:37:08 [error] 11380#0: *21 connect() failed (111: Connection refused) while connecting to upstream, client: 88.202.***.**, server: <a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>, request: "GET / HTTP/1.1", upstream: "fastcgi://<a href="http://127.0.0.1:9000" rel="noreferrer" target="_blank">127.0.0.1:9000</a>", host: "<a href="http://domain.com" rel="noreferrer" target="_blank">domain.com</a>"<br>
>>>>>>>><br>
>>>>>>>> Вам же написано ж четко в логе все что нужно.<br>
>>>>>>>> Вы запустили на 9000 порту fastcgi-сервис? И почему нет?<br>
>>>>>>>><br>
>>>>>>>> --<br>
>>>>>>>> Lystopad Aleksandr<br>
>>>>>>>><br>
>>>>>>>> _______________________________________________<br>
>>>>>>>> nginx-ru mailing list<br>
>>>>>>>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>>>>>>>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
>>>>>>><br>
>>>>>>> --<br>
>>>>>>> С уважением, Евгений Сухарников.<br>
>>>>>>><br>
>>>>>>> ,<br>
>>>>>>><br>
>>>>>>> _______________________________________________<br>
>>>>>>> nginx-ru mailing list<br>
>>>>>>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>>>>>>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
>>>>>><br>
>>>>>> _______________________________________________<br>
>>>>>> nginx-ru mailing list<br>
>>>>>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>>>>>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
>>>>><br>
>>>>> --<br>
>>>>> Dmitry Goryainov<br>
>>>>><br>
>>>>> ,<br>
>>>>><br>
>>>>> _______________________________________________<br>
>>>>> nginx-ru mailing list<br>
>>>>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>>>>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
>>>><br>
>>>> _______________________________________________<br>
>>>> nginx-ru mailing list<br>
>>>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>>>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
>>><br>
>>> --<br>
>>> Dmitry Goryainov<br>
>>><br>
>>> ,<br>
>>><br>
>>> _______________________________________________<br>
>>> nginx-ru mailing list<br>
>>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
>><br>
>> _______________________________________________<br>
>> nginx-ru mailing list<br>
>>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
>>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
><br>
> _______________________________________________<br>
> nginx-ru mailing list<br>
> <a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
> <a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a><br>
<br>
_______________________________________________<br>
nginx-ru mailing list<br>
<a href="mailto:nginx-ru@nginx.org">nginx-ru@nginx.org</a><br>
<a href="http://mailman.nginx.org/mailman/listinfo/nginx-ru" rel="noreferrer" target="_blank">http://mailman.nginx.org/mailman/listinfo/nginx-ru</a></div></div></blockquote></div><br><br clear="all"><div><br></div>-- <br><div class="gmail_signature">Dmitry Goryainov<br><br></div>
</div>